1. Plug in the power cord and the power indicator will light up.
2. When a battery pack is inserted, the green charging light will blink to indicate charging
is taking place at the current moment.
3. If discharging of battery pack is desired (strongly recommended), press the
“DISCHARGE” button. At discharging mode, the green blinking light will now
turned into a constant red light indicating that the battery pack is now being discharged.
If you want to cancel the discharge, just press “DISCHARGE” button again.
4. When discharging is completed, it will automatically switch to the charging mode
where the green blinking light will appear again.
5. The charging time for a battery pack is approximately 3~6 hours (600mA).
6. When charging is completed, a constant green light will appear to indicate that the
battery pack is fully charged.
7. When the battery pack is at 90% charged state, trickle charging will take over to ensure
the longevity of the battery pack and as well as to ensure the battery pack is 100%
charged.
8. When the battery pack’s temperature exceeds 50
, the charger will go into protective
mode and charging will be discontinued.
9. To prolong the life of the battery pack, it is recommended that the battery pack be fully
discharged prior to every re-charging.
